Strategies for implementing observable, debuggable error handling patterns that surface useful context from no-code failures.
Building robust no-code systems hinges on observable, debuggable error handling that surfaces actionable context, enabling rapid diagnosis, informed remediation, and resilient product experiences across diverse users and edge cases.
July 16, 2025
Facebook X Reddit
No-code platforms empower teams to assemble workflows rapidly, yet the speed can obscure failure modes that matter most. To keep reliability front and center, design error surfaces that communicate where in the flow a problem occurred, what inputs were involved, and which components interacted. Start by mapping critical touchpoints across data ingress, transformations, and external integrations. Then define a minimal, consistent error payload that surfaces the exact operation, the user’s action, and a snapshot of key variables without exposing sensitive data. This foundation helps both developers and citizen developers understand failures without wading through logs. Over time, you’ll accumulate a library of error patterns that inform better guards, tests, and user guidance.
Effective observability in no-code contexts relies on instrumentation that fits non-developers’ mental models. Use dashboards that annotate failures with visual cues, timelines, and linked artifacts such as screenshots, form data summaries, or excerpted messages. Avoid technical jargon and present outcomes in concrete terms: “Payment gateway returned 503 during checkout step,” rather than “Unhandled exception.” Pair these visuals with lightweight traces showing the sequence of steps leading to the error, including which rule or condition triggered the fault. Establish automated alerts that rise for recurring patterns, not just single anomalies, so teams can address systemic issues promptly.
Standardize failure context and automate escalation to resolution.
In practice, patterns emerge from repeated failure scenarios, and these patterns should be captured in a living rule set. Begin with a taxonomy of error classes rooted in business impact—data integrity, transaction completion, and user permissions. For each class, define what constitutes a meaningful context: the values of essential fields, the identity of the user or service, and the version of the workflow being executed. Store this information in a centralized, accessible catalog so builders can reuse it across apps and automations. Then codify recommended remediation steps so operators can act quickly, whether reattempting the operation, prompting for missing inputs, or escalating to a specialist. The goal is a repeatable playbook that reduces resolution time.
ADVERTISEMENT
ADVERTISEMENT
No-code systems thrive on composable components, which makes it critical to surface the right context at the right time. Attach contextual metadata to every failing step: the component name, the input schema, the preconditions checked, and the external dependency involved. When possible, include a lightweight rollback plan or a safe-fail path to preserve user data and preserve trust. Implement guardrails that detect schema mismatches, rate limits, or timeout conditions and translate them into actionable messages. Designers should agree on a standard message template for all errors, ensuring consistency in tone, guidance, and next steps across teams and products.
Align engineering discipline with user-facing clarity in error handling.
A practical approach to scaling observability is to separate the what from the why, enabling teams to search efficiently while still receiving rich diagnostic details. Create a uniform error schema that captures essential fields such as errorCode, stepName, userContext, timestamp, and a compact input fingerprint. The fingerprint helps identify where similar inputs yielded different results, highlighting nondeterministic behavior. Design automation that correlates disparate failures into cohesive incidents, grouping them by root cause rather than incident name alone. Then route these incidents to the right specialists, with a concise briefing that includes the immediate impact, probable causes, and any recent changes that could have influenced the outcome. Clarity accelerates resolution.
ADVERTISEMENT
ADVERTISEMENT
Beyond incident management, nurturing a culture of proactive debugging matters as much as reactive fixes. Encourage teams to conduct regular “blast radius” reviews of failure events, examining what would happen if the service scales, if a specific integration changes, or if a user operates at the edge of expected inputs. Promote the use of synthetic tests and scripted scenarios that mimic real user journeys through the no-code builder. These exercises reveal gaps in observability, reveal brittle assumptions, and validate that error surfaces deliver the necessary context under varied conditions. The end result is a more robust platform with predictable, trackable failure behavior.
Integrate feedback loops that close the gap between failure and fix.
User-facing error messages should be concise yet informative, especially for non-technical audiences. Translate technical findings into guidance that helps users recover gracefully, such as retry suggestions, alternative actions, or direct links to support resources. The tone must remain empathetic, not punitive, and messages should avoid exposing sensitive system details. Provide in-context recovery options within the same screen, when feasible, so users can resolve simple problems without leaving their current flow. Where a problem requires back-end attention, offer an estimated timeline and a transparent escalation channel. By coupling clarity with actionable steps, you reduce frustration and preserve productivity even during hiccups.
To ensure long-term value, tie error handling improvements to product metrics that matter to stakeholders. Track not only the frequency of failures but also user impact metrics like time to resolution, number of users affected, and the rate of successful recoveries. Use these signals to prioritize enhancements in the no-code environment, such as more robust validation rules, better input governance, or streamlined connectors. Regularly review dashboards with cross-functional teams to ensure everyone understands where risks lie and how they will be mitigated. A data-driven approach to observable errors fosters continuous improvement across the platform.
ADVERTISEMENT
ADVERTISEMENT
Create sustainable, scalable practices around failure analysis and repair.
A core objective of debuggable error handling is to illuminate the causal chain without overwhelming stakeholders. Implement lightweight traceability that connects user actions to outcomes, while preserving privacy. This can involve linking a displayed error to a trace identifier that appears in a back-end log for authorized personnel. Ensure that traces capture the sequence of decisions the no-code engine made, including conditional branches and the outcomes of validations. When the same failure recurs, compare traces to spot drift or unintended side effects. By mapping cause to effect in a repeatable way, teams can identify root causes faster and verify that fixes address the actual problem.
Another crucial aspect is ensuring that error data remains actionable as the platform evolves. Guardrails should adapt to new features, integrations, and data schemas so that previous incidents do not become obsolete reminders. Maintain backward-compatible error formats or clearly deprecate obsolete fields with migration guidance. Automate the enrichment of failure records with version tags, feature flags, and contributor notes to reflect evolving knowledge about the system. This evolving observability ensures that future debugging benefits from historical context and accumulated wisdom, not just momentary insight.
Long-term success comes from embedding error handling discipline into the development lifecycle. Start by embedding observable error patterns into design reviews, risk assessments, and test plans. Include criteria for when to enhance error surfaces, add new metadata, or adjust thresholds for alerts. Without guardrails, teams may chase noise or misinterpret fleeting spikes as systemic flaws. With careful thresholds and agreed-upon definitions of “meaningful failure,” you can balance responsiveness with stability. Documented playbooks, sample traces, and proven remediation steps become a shared asset that accelerates onboarding and reduces cognitive load for new contributors.
Finally, measure the health of your no-code observability program and iterate. Set quarterly goals for coverage, context richness, and mean time to repair, and track progress against them. Celebrate improvements that noticeably reduce user friction and bolster confidence in automation. Encourage experimentation with different visualization formats, alerting strategies, and failure classifications to learn what resonates with your teams. A mature program blends technical rigor with user empathy, turning error handling from a necessary burden into a strategic advantage that sustains trust and drives continuous delivery.
Related Articles
In no-code environments, choosing data retention policies and archival methods requires balancing regulatory compliance, cost efficiency, user needs, and system performance while preserving accessibility and privacy over time.
July 28, 2025
Implementing robust secret escrow and regular rotation within no-code ecosystems reduces risk, protects sensitive credentials, and ensures teams can collaborate seamlessly across connectors, apps, and environments while maintaining strict governance.
August 02, 2025
In no-code environments, clear ownership and stewardship foster trusted data, accountable decisions, and consistent quality across apps, integrations, and user communities by defining roles, responsibilities, and governance rituals.
August 08, 2025
Effective governance for no-code platforms blends clear standards, scalable processes, and continuous feedback, ensuring pilots evolve into enterprise-wide adoption without compromising security, compliance, or innovation across diverse teams.
July 18, 2025
As organizations increasingly adopt no-code platforms, establishing secure, auditable migration paths becomes essential to protect data integrity, maintain regulatory compliance, and ensure operational continuity across vendor transitions without sacrificing speed or innovation.
August 08, 2025
Crafting durable developer experience standards for no-code ecosystems requires a balanced mix of governance, reusable patterns, and measurable quality expectations that guide extensions while empowering builders of all backgrounds.
August 07, 2025
This evergreen guide explores practical, vendor-agnostic methods to validate end-to-end security controls when composing no-code workflows with multiple service providers, addressing risk, assurance, and governance.
July 14, 2025
Organizations can design ongoing, scalable training and certification strategies that empower citizen developers, align with business goals, and maintain governance, quality, and security while expanding no-code capabilities across teams.
August 03, 2025
Designing trustworthy no-code data export and archiving requires robust lineage tracking, explicit consent handling, access controls, and durable audit trails that remain resilient across evolving platforms and workflows.
August 02, 2025
In no-code environments, building resilient connectors and adapters requires deliberate abstraction, versioning, and contract-first thinking to ensure changes in underlying services pose minimal disruption to composite applications.
July 30, 2025
This evergreen guide outlines practical strategies for conducting privacy impact assessments (PIAs) tailored to low-code and no-code development environments, emphasizing risk assessment, stakeholder collaboration, and sustainable privacy governance.
July 22, 2025
Observability in no-code contexts connects data from apps to business results by aligning metrics, traces, and logs with clear outcomes, creating a measurable feedback loop that informs decisions and accelerates impact.
July 24, 2025
In modern no-code ecosystems, building secure delegation frameworks means enabling time-limited access tied to specific tasks, while protecting credentials through ephemeral tokens, audit trails, and policy-driven restrictions that minimize risk without hindering productivity.
July 19, 2025
A comprehensive guide to designing, implementing, and maintaining a robust plugin certification program that protects users, preserves product integrity, and accelerates trustworthy ecosystem growth for no-code extensions.
July 29, 2025
Building a resilient no-code ecosystem requires intentional incentives, practical governance, and ongoing education that motivate teams to reuse components, document decisions, and comply with standards while delivering reliable automation at scale.
July 15, 2025
Designing a robust enterprise template lifecycle for no-code assets requires clear stages, governance, measurable quality gates, and ongoing stewardship; this evergreen framework helps organizations scale safely while accelerating delivery.
July 18, 2025
Organizations leveraging no-code and low-code platforms gain scalability when metadata and labeling are standardized across artifacts, enabling robust lifecycle management, auditability, and governance. A deliberate, repeatable approach reduces confusion, accelerates collaboration, and protects data integrity, while supporting automation, traceability, and compliance across diverse teams and tooling ecosystems.
July 18, 2025
Building scalable event-driven architectures enables low-code components to respond to complex enterprise events with resilience, observability, and flexibility across heterogeneous systems, while preserving developer velocity.
July 18, 2025
A practical framework for building fail-safe controls that pause, quarantine, or halt risky automations before they can trigger business-wide disruptions, with scalable governance and real-time oversight for resilient operations.
July 31, 2025
Temporary access controls must balance ease of maintenance with strong safeguards, ensuring authorized access is timely, revocable, auditable, and minimally privileged, without breeding persistent privileges or blind spots during troubleshooting.
July 14, 2025